
We often view sleep as a block of time to fill with a nebulous sense of “enough” before an alarm clock pulls us back to our responsibilities. But sleep is more structured than that, and understanding this structure can make mornings feel remarkably easier.
It’s more helpful to think of rest as a cycle, like laps in a pool, rather than as a straight line of unconsciousness. Each sleep cycle lasts about 90 minutes and consists of different stages: drifting light sleep, restorative deep sleep, and vivid REM dreaming. These cycles repeat through the night, and where you interrupt them matters a great deal.

If you’ve ever slept a full eight hours yet woken up feeling like you’ve been hit by a truck, chances are you were pulled from deep sleep mid-cycle. That abrupt interruption—known as sleep inertia—disrupts your brain’s transition from rest to wakefulness, often leaving you disoriented for hours.
You can avoid that unpleasant awakening by scheduling your sleep to conclude at the end of a complete cycle. This is the essence of the 90-minute rule: plan your wake-up so that it falls at the natural end of a cycle.
For instance, if your morning begins at 7:00 a.m., a bedtime of 11:30 p.m. allows for five cycles (7.5 hours), while 10:00 p.m. would offer six (9 hours). It’s equally important to account for falling asleep, which typically takes 15 to 20 minutes.
Through this approach, waking becomes smoother, energy becomes more consistent, and your mood notably improves.

There are now several tools that help take the guesswork out of the equation. Sleep-tracking apps and online calculators let you plug in either a wake-up or bedtime and return the optimal match for your cycle. Many even track movement and sound to identify when you’re in lighter sleep, adjusting alarms accordingly.
The double-alarm method, which sets one alarm for 90 minutes before your actual wake-up time and another for your target, is one tactic that has gained popularity. You may find you naturally rise during that first alarm window, and when you do, you’re more likely to feel alert.
The rule also works surprisingly well for naps. Short naps under 30 minutes can refresh you without touching deep sleep, while a full 90-minute nap lets your brain complete a full cycle. Anything in between often leaves you groggy and unfocused.
Yet, it’s important to acknowledge that this technique isn’t mathematically perfect. The 90-minute cycle is an average. Some people may cycle every 80 minutes, others closer to 100. Factors like stress, body temperature, alcohol, or medications can subtly shift your rhythms.
Still, this method remains a particularly innovative foundation. Rather than aimlessly chasing eight hours, you’re aligning your rest with the way your body naturally functions. That alone can lead to better sleep quality—without increasing time in bed.
Consistency is another important factor. Your body’s internal rhythm, known as the circadian clock, is strengthened when you maintain regular sleep and wake times, even on weekends. Over time, this makes it significantly easier to fall asleep and wake up at the right points in your cycle.
